Yunnan: China's Most Diverse Province
Yunnan Province in southwest China offers incredible diversity - from snow-capped Himalayan peaks to tropical rainforests, ancient towns to modern cities, and home to 25 ethnic minorities. This is China at its most colorful and culturally rich.
Top Destinations in Yunnan
1. Kunming - Spring City
Stay: 1-2 days
- Stone Forest: UNESCO karst formations (¥130)
- Green Lake Park: Free, beautiful year-round
- Best for: Gateway city, pleasant weather
2. Dali - Ancient Town Charm
Stay: 2-3 days
- Dali Old Town: Ming Dynasty architecture
- Erhai Lake: Cycling, boat rides
- Three Pagodas: Iconic Buddhist site (¥75)
- Vibe: Relaxed, backpacker-friendly
3. Lijiang - UNESCO Heritage Town
Stay: 2-3 days
- Old Town: Cobblestone streets, canals
- Jade Dragon Snow Mountain: 5,596m peak
- Naxi Culture: Unique matriarchal society
- Note: Very touristy but beautiful
4. Shangri-La - Tibetan Culture
Stay: 2-3 days
- Altitude: 3,200m (acclimatize!)
- Songzanlin Monastery: "Little Potala Palace"
- Tiger Leaping Gorge: World-class hiking
- Best Season: May-October
5. Yuanyang Rice Terraces
Stay: 2 days
- Best Time: November-March (water reflection)
- Sunrise/Sunset: Photographer's paradise
- Hani Culture: 1,300 years of terrace farming

Tiger Leaping Gorge Trek
One of the world's deepest gorges
- Duration: 2 days/1 night
- Difficulty: Moderate-challenging
- Distance: 22km high trail
- Best Time: April-June, September-November
- Accommodation: Guesthouses along trail
- Cost: Entry ¥65, guesthouse ¥80-150
Ethnic Minorities
Yunnan is home to 25 of China's 56 ethnic groups:
- Naxi: Lijiang area, Dongba culture
- Bai: Dali region, tie-dye crafts
- Tibetan: Shangri-La, Buddhist culture
- Hani: Yuanyang, rice terraces
- Yi: Various regions, Torch Festival
